Abstract
PURPOSE: To detect extremely small piercing crack with facility and certainty using a simple method, by making sodium in the crack a strong alkaline substance, and then by making it contact a discoloration reacting substance.
CONSTITUTION: Water is applied to a surface 5 of a wall 1 of an equipment of a pipeline, etc. in such a manner so to wipe it with a distilled-water-absorbed gauze or sanitary cotton, etc., and sodium or sodium compound 3 near the surface in a piercing crack 2 is made to react the water to be turned into a strong alkaline substance 4, and then, a substance, which is discolored by reacting alkaline substance, such as phenolphthalien, etc. is applied to the surface 5 through a gauze or cotton, etc. By doing so, the discoloration reacting substance reacts the strong alkaline substance 4 to be discolored, and position of the piercing crack 2 is thus indicated. Further, by utilizing a paper towel or cloth, etc. which had absorbed phenolphthalein solution diluted with distilled water, the operation can be further simplified.
